![discord sidenotes in call discord sidenotes in call](https://i.ytimg.com/vi/sfx5Yi-4K3M/maxresdefault.jpg)
![discord sidenotes in call discord sidenotes in call](https://i.ytimg.com/vi/CvgWSdO-Rn0/maxresdefault.jpg)
So, Markdown cannot be used inside sidenotes. Inside of the shortcode ends up with block elements. The Markdown renderer wraps text in paragraphs, which are block elements, the Shortcode's definition, and then finally placing that into the final output. Hugo implements Markdown inside shortcodesīy rendering the "inner" part of the shortcode, substituting the result into the So, even though conceptually (and visually) the content of the sidenote is a block, The browser will automatically close the tag, breaking the rest of the page. When you try to put a block element, such as inside , Markdown rendering generates tags.Īccording the to spec, tags cannot have a block element inside The first concern was not having to write raw HTML to add the side notes,īut this is fairly simple with Hugo’s shortcodes: I write the HTML once inĪ new sidenote shortcode, then call the shortcode from my posts. Out of spite, I want my site to work without any JavaScript,Īnd these notes are no exception. To my frustration, a lot of the websites I commonly visit ended up broken:ĭisquss all fail catastrophically when they aren’t allowed to load dozens of scriptsįrom various sources. That blocks JavaScript loaded from domains other than the one you’re visiting. This is driven by my recent installation of uMatrix. In which there are too many sidenotes and not enough space.Ī major goal of mine in implementing these sidenotes was to avoid the use of JavaScript. Sidenotes can also appear on the left of the screen, to help prevent situations Otherwise, the example sidenote should be visible Portion of the text, which is the part to which the sidenote is related or refers to. In this case, you can click or tap the underlined If you’re on a mobile device, the content is hidden by default: there’s no Making sentences more difficult to understand is a no-go. To help explain stuff (like the compiler series), I found that sidenotes were a feature that I didn’t even know I needed.Ī lot of my writing seems to use small parenthesized remarks (like this), which,Īlthough it doesn’t break the flow in a grammatical sense, lengthens the A friend recently showed me a website, the design of which I really liked: